7.7 Resolving Ground Loop Issues
Ground loops are a common problem within any environment where multiple electrical devices
are connected to the same power circuit. In complex setups, the cause(s) of the noise can be
difficult to find. Ground loops are perceived usually as a hum or buzz in your audio signal, but
this can also transmit and amplify other sounds from the devices connected to the circuit. For
example, one very common problem is that you hear internal clicking sounds created by your
computer.

Native Instruments Komplete Audio 6 Specifications

General IconGeneral
Audio Resolution24-bit/192kHz
Power SupplyUSB bus powered
Audio Interface TypeUSB
Simultaneous I/O6 x 6
Number of Preamps2
A/D Resolution24-bit/192kHz
MIDI I/O1 x MIDI In, 1 x MIDI Out
USBUSB 2.0
Phantom PowerYes
Digital Inputs1 x Coax (S/PDIF)
Digital Outputs1 x Coax (S/PDIF)
Headphone Output1 x 1/4" TRS
Software IncludedKomplete Elements
Outputs4 x analog (2 x TRS, 2 x RCA)
